Philip Duane Gorman

Sep 30, 1950 - Jan 29, 2021

Philip Gorman, age 70, of Sheboygan, passed away from pancreatic cancer on Friday, January 29, 2021 at his home. He was born on September 30, 1950 at Marinette General Hospital to Alva Lee and Alice Marie Gorman. Philip graduated from Oconto Falls High School with the class of 1968.
He was an avid hunter, outdoorsman, enjoyed golfing and was a NASCAR fan. Philip also enjoyed fishing, watching the Packers and watching the Brewers in his garage with his friends. He was employed by the Kohler Company for 46 years until his retirement in 2015. One of Philip’s proud achievements was building a cabin on his wooded land with the help of his family and many friends. He enjoyed sitting around the campfire and playing Cheeky Cheeky! Philip was known to be the ultimate prankster with everyone.
Philip is survived by his sons, Todd (Barb) Gorman and Tim (Wendy) Gorman; grandchildren, Aaron, Collin, Connor, Callie, Kevin and Kyle Gorman; sisters, Betty Miller and Pat Sprout. He is further survived by many nieces, nephews and special close friends. Philip is preceded in death by his parents; sisters, Eunice Patz and Blanche Ott and brothers, Marvin, Raymond and Jerry Gorman. Philip was a good father, grandfather and friend. He will be greatly missed.
Visitation will be held on Friday, February 5, 2021 at Reinbold-Novak Funeral Home, 1535 S. 12th St., Sheboygan, from 2:00 p.m. until the time of service at 4:00 p.m. A private burial will take place at a later date.
